DECT radio unit with outdoor supply
The following principles are to be observed when installing DECT radio units on
outdoor premises:
• Choose a central position and avoid flat penetration angles
• Ensure the chosen location is protected from the weather
• Make sure the installation site is chosen sufficiently high to be protected from
acts of vandalism
[1] A flat penetration angle results in a greater attenuation (approx. 30 dB)
[2] A steeper penetration angle results in a smaller attenuation (approx. 20 dB)
Fig. 14 Optimum positioning of the DECT radio unit on outside walls
Tip:
For outdoor supply always check the use of an external antenna
(together with an SB-8ANT) or the use of a DECT Repeater. This may result
in an optimum and therefore a more cost-effective solution.
